UBS pays €435m for CCR

UBS Global Asset Management will complete its fourth asset management acquisition in a year by acquiring Commerzbank's Paris-based funds business, as Financial News first reported last month.

UBS today said that it has agreed to acquire the Caisse Centrale de Reescompte Group from Commerzbank for €435m ($619m). The deal is expected to close in the first three months of next year, pending regulatory approval.
